Shell Shock Ipa Restaurants in George Town
The best places in George Town to eat Shell Shock Ipa. Our interactive map features all restaurants around George Town who offer this dish to eat out or take away.
Show restaurants on map
This is a list of all the eateries where you can order Shell Shock Ipa or dine out.
4.6
Menu
Table booking
4.6
Menu
Table booking
City: George Town, 389 West Bay Rd, George Town, Cayman Islands
"Amazing experience. We came her for anniversary dinner"
Shell Shock Ipa
You can find Shell Shock Ipa in Restaurants. We help you find a restaurant in your area where it tastes best.
Price
Feedback
These reviews refer only to the mentioned ingredients.